Tyler, the Creator, born Tyler Gregory Okonma, is an American artist from Hawthorne, California, born in 1991. He began his musical career at age 14 with the hip hop group Odd Future Wolf Gang Kill Them All (OFWGKTA). Known for his eclectic musical style that spans from hip hop to jazz, funk to soul, Tyler has released six studio albums: *Bastard*, *Goblin*, *Wolf*, *Flower Boy*, *Igor* and *Call Me If You Get Lost*. The latter earned him his first Grammy Award in the Best Rap Album category in 2022. Besides music, Tyler is a talented fashion designer and stylist, collaborating with brands like Converse and Golf Wang. He has also acted in films such as *The Grinch* (2018) and *You're My Everything*. Some of his most representative songs include "Yonkers", "EARFQUAKE", "See You Again" and "Wusyaname".
